Woman charged with DUI after crashing into parked cars in Tunbridge

1 min read

TUNBRIDGE — A 22-year-old woman from Randolph Center was charged with driving under the influence after a late-night crash involving three vehicles on Dec. 15.

Vermont State Police responded to a report of a collision on Vermont Route 110 near Spring Rd. at approximately 11:34 p.m.

Authorities identified the driver as Rachel Davis, who was traveling northbound when she veered off the road and struck two unoccupied parked cars.

During the investigation, troopers determined that Davis was under the influence of alcohol.

She was subsequently processed for DUI.

No injuries were reported at the scene of the accident.
